63 lines
1.1 KiB
Vue
63 lines
1.1 KiB
Vue
<template>
|
|
<view class="content">
|
|
<div class="item">
|
|
<div>姓名</div>
|
|
<div>{{ userInfo.name }}</div>
|
|
</div>
|
|
<div class="item">
|
|
<div>身份证号</div>
|
|
<div>{{ userInfo.idcard }}</div>
|
|
</div>
|
|
<div class="item">
|
|
<div>年龄</div>
|
|
<div>{{ userInfo.age }}</div>
|
|
</div>
|
|
<div class="item">
|
|
<div>性别</div>
|
|
<div>{{ userInfo.sex }}</div>
|
|
</div>
|
|
<div class="item">
|
|
<div>联系方式</div>
|
|
<div>{{ userInfo.phone }}</div>
|
|
</div>
|
|
<div class="item">
|
|
<div>部门</div>
|
|
<div>{{ userInfo.departName }}</div>
|
|
</div>
|
|
</view>
|
|
</template>
|
|
|
|
<script>
|
|
export default {
|
|
data() {
|
|
return {
|
|
userInfo: {}
|
|
}
|
|
},
|
|
onLoad(opt) {
|
|
opt = JSON.parse(opt.params)
|
|
console.log('🚀 ~ onLoad ~ opt:', opt)
|
|
this.userInfo = opt
|
|
}
|
|
}
|
|
</script>
|
|
|
|
<style lang="scss" scoped>
|
|
.content {
|
|
margin: 10px;
|
|
padding: 10px;
|
|
|
|
.item {
|
|
padding: 10px;
|
|
margin-bottom: 10px;
|
|
font-size: 16px;
|
|
height: 40px;
|
|
background: #fff;
|
|
border-radius: 5px;
|
|
display: flex;
|
|
justify-content: space-between;
|
|
align-items: center;
|
|
}
|
|
}
|
|
</style>
|